Make Unlocking Cell Phones Legal Again
Category: mobile
They need 5383 signatures more to reach 100,000 signatures by feb 23. If you care about hardware freedom and the ability to do what you want with electronics you purchase then please sign this petition to repeal the ruling that made cell phone unlocking illegal.
